John is a 63 year old alcoholic with a five year history of ulcers. Recently when self-medicating for a back condition, John consumed five times the recommended daily dose of an over-the-counter pain reliever. Soon afterwards John developed a severe episode of nausea and vomiting. Twelve hours later, his wife brings him to the local emergency room. The ER PA draws blood samples for drug analysis and reviews the Mathew-Rumack nomogram prior to administering an antidote to prevent further toxicity. What analgesic did John most likely take to cause this problem? Group of answer choices acetaminophen ibuprofen aspirin naproxen
